Book Description:
|
This report assesses the contribution of defense spending in Hawaii to the overall levels of output, employment, and earnings in Hawaii¹s economy. The analysis finds that spending on defense procurement and personnel was related to 18 percent of Hawaii¹s 2009 GDP and 101,000 jobs. A sensitivity analysis indicates that defense personnel savings rates and where some earnings are spent could decrease the result by around 10 percent.
